Title

Impact Of Rising Fuel Prices on EV Sales in India

Abstract

There is rising levels of air pollution all over the world and especially India has 6 cities in 10 most polluted cities in the world (1). The Indian government has expanded the market for Electric-Vehicles by bringing in schemes like FAME (Faster Adoption and Manufacture of Electric (Hybrid) Vehicle As per FAME -22 Scheme both direct subsidy to Electric two wheel purchases and battery charging is provided. Added to it the rising Fuel prices has further pushed the world towards a faster EV adaptation. The Russia-Ukraine war, COVID-19 & cartelization by OPEC countries were some of the concerns too. India suffers from a huge current account deficit which is majorly contributed by the Import bills of crude oil. (25% of India’s import is of crude oil costing about US$ 119billion and India’s CAD for current year is $13.4 Billion). To avoid this problem of dependence on crude oil, the Government of India is pushing for a faster EV adoption using schemes like FAME-II. With rising demand for EVs, Automobile sector in India is now focusing more on EV production. In this paper the area of focus will be towards the rise in EV sales in India with respect to rise in Fuel prices year on year. This paper looks into the relationship between fuel prices and Auto sales and using innovative Fibonacci series make sales growth forecast for Electric 2 wheelers.
